The Claim

Mutations in the PRSS1 gene are strongly associated with hereditary pancreatitis and lead to increased intrapancreatic trypsin activity.

The Short Version

Established pathogenic PRSS1 variants such as R122H and N29I are definitively linked to hereditary pancreatitis and are well-supported by converging biochemical, animal model, and clinical genetics evidence as increasing intrapancreatic trypsin activity. The claim's unqualified reference to "PRSS1 mutations" slightly overgeneralizes, since not all PRSS1 variants produce the same functional effect. Additionally, direct measurement of increased intracellular trypsin in human patients remains limited, though the mechanistic evidence is strong.

Caveats

  • The claim applies most accurately to well-characterized high-penetrance gain-of-function PRSS1 variants (e.g., R122H, N29I); not all PRSS1 mutations have been shown to increase trypsin activity.
  • Direct evidence of increased intracellular trypsin activity in human patients is limited; the mechanistic support comes primarily from in vitro biochemical studies and animal models.
  • Hereditary pancreatitis is genetically heterogeneous — other genes such as SPINK1, CFTR, and CTRC can also contribute to or modify disease risk, so PRSS1 is a major but not exclusive cause.
